Target intelligence / Profile preview
The pro-inflammatory cytokine network in intestinal tissue is a complex signaling system involving proteins such as Tumor Necrosis Factor-alpha (TNF-alpha), Interleukin-6 (IL-6), and the Interleukin-12/23 axis, which are central to the pathogenesis of inflammatory bowel disease (IBD) (Neurath, 2014). In a healthy gut, these cytokines facilitate immune surveillance and epithelial repair, but their dysregulation leads to chronic inflammation and tissue destruction seen in Crohn's disease and ulcerative colitis (Friedrich et al., 2019). Therapeutic strategies target this network by using monoclonal antibodies to neutralize specific cytokines, such as Infliximab for TNF-alpha or Ustekinumab for the p40 subunit of IL-12 and IL-23. Additionally, small molecule inhibitors of Janus kinases (JAKs) are used to block the downstream signaling pathways shared by multiple cytokines in this network (Mao et al., 2017). While effective, modulating this network carries risks of systemic immunosuppression and increased susceptibility to opportunistic infections (Salas et al., 2020). Monitoring the activity of this network is typically achieved through biomarkers like fecal calprotectin and C-reactive protein, which reflect the degree of mucosal inflammation.
The network is modulated through the neutralization of specific pro-inflammatory cytokines (e.g., TNF-alpha, IL-12, IL-23) or the inhibition of downstream intracellular signaling pathways, such as the Janus kinase (JAK)-signal transducer and activator of transcription (STAT) pathway, to resolve chronic intestinal inflammation.
